General Information: Belfast International Airport is the primary
airport serving the Northern Ireland and over 4.8 million passengers travel through
the terminal each year. Belfast is the 11th busiest airport in the UK in terms of
passenger volume and is the busiest airport in Northern Ireland. It is situated
approximately 18 miles north-west of Belfast. It is the closest all-weather airport
in Europe to America, and therefore is ideally positioned for the rapid turnaround
and repositioning of trans-atlantic flights. Belfast International handles many
flights to the USA, with scheduled services to New York – Newark, Orlando, Vancouver
and Toronto, as well as flights to the major European hubs.
